In the north of Maple Country, chaos reigned. With the complete fall of Yun Province, the people of the realm had utterly lost faith in the imperial court.
In a mass exodus, the populace of several northern provinces began fleeing south, fearing death beneath the Marauders' iron hooves.
The imperial court, too, realized that its current military strength was utterly inadequate to withstand the Marauders' relentless advance.
Finally, in a state of profound grief, the Taiwen Emperor issued a decree to relocate the capital south.
Fleeing in disarray, the sovereign of a nation felt his heart bleed.
This retreat, even if Maple Country survived, would forever brand him as a disgrace in the annals of history.
The legacy painstakingly built by generations of emperors before him had been utterly squandered in his reign.
While crossing Small Jade Ridge would guarantee absolute safety, the treacherous mountain range served as a natural barrier, making it nearly impossible for ordinary armies to traverse.
However, retaking the lost territory would become an insurmountable challenge. He was leaving his descendants a problem of epic proportions!
At this thought, the Taiwen Emperor even felt an impulse to commit suicide in the Golden Hall.
"Why has it come to this? Why has it come to this?"
In his bedroom, the Taiwen Emperor continued to lament, his eyes bloodshot, resembling a stray dog.
Shengtian's preparations for the southward relocation were proceeding at full speed, while a persistent cloud of sorrow hung over the entire palace.
This once resplendent and extravagantly luxurious imperial city was about to change hands.
On the eve of their departure, another earth-shattering case was solved!
The Grand Councilor had embezzled over 80,000 taels from the three armies. Over the years, he had even been selling strategic resources like salt and iron to neighboring countries, amassing a vast fortune!
This news sent shockwaves across Shengtian and even most of the Maple Country.
In an instant, the Maple Country's government lost all public trust, and this rickety old boat was once again revealed to have a gaping hole.
The Taiwen Emperor flew into a rage, even blaming the Grand Councilor for the entire war's failure.
He immediately ordered the Maple Guard to arrest the Grand Councilor as quickly as possible and execute him publicly before the relocation.
Unfortunately, the Grand Councilor, having gotten wind of the impending raid in advance, had already made meticulous arrangements for his escape. He had long since fled.
By the time Commander Qian Hong of the Maple Guard arrived at his mansion with her troops, the place was deserted.
Boom!
With a grim expression, Qian Hong kicked down the mansion's gate.
"Search the place! Arrest any survivors!"
The remaining Maple Guards swiftly sprang into action, thoroughly ransacking the mansion with utmost efficiency.
Soon, a Maple Guard emerged and reported, "Commander Qian, we've discovered a hidden cellar underground. We found a cache of property that hadn't been moved yet."
"Lead the way!" Qian Hong commanded coldly.
In the mansion's backyard, a cellar concealed beneath a pile of hay suddenly came into view.
As Qian Hong entered, her cold, elegant face was instantly etched with frost.
Before her lay a substantial pile of silver, clearly left behind in the Grand Councilor's haste to escape.
"This silver here barely exceeds thirty thousand taels. That means he must have taken at least another fifty thousand taels with him!"
What an outrageous sum—fifty thousand taels of silver! It was simply too shocking to behold.
Just the mountain of silver piled before her was enough to make anyone gasp.
Bang!
Qian Hong slammed her fist into a nearby wooden shelf. The force of the blow shattered the wood into splinters, reducing it to nothing but sawdust.
"This silver represents the pensions for soldiers who died on the battlefield, the wages sent home by soldiers stationed on the border for years, the supplies of salt and iron sent to the army, the blood and sweat of countless taxpayers, and the lives of countless people!"
The more she spoke, the more Qian Hong's body trembled with rage. She hadn't felt such unbridled fury in a long time.
Having served with the army for years, she knew all too well what this silver represented.
"At any cost, no matter where that dog of an official flees, he must be captured! I will personally flay him alive!"
At the border of Yun Province, several horse-drawn carriages loaded with overflowing chests of gold and silver sped along the road.
Inside the lead carriage, Grand Councilor Gao Yudong sat, his face etched with the relief of surviving a near-death experience.
"That was close. I have no idea how the Maple Guard got wind of this, but the whole scheme was exposed."
"We could have taken this money and followed the court south. Now, we have no choice but to throw ourselves into the arms of the Marauders."
Also in the carriage sat a young man of sixteen or seventeen, his face pale with shock.
"Father, are we really going to join the Marauders? When will we ever be able to return to Shengtian?!"
Gao Yudong smiled warmly. "Don't worry, son. It won't be long before we're back in Shengtian. Now it's the Grasslanders' turn to rule the world."
Hearing this, the handsome young man's face lit up with a cheerful grin. "So our family is actually this rich! Why didn't you tell me before, Father?"
The Grand Councilor shook his head. "Silly boy, I wouldn't have dared to use it before. My plan was to retire in a few years, take this money south, and spend it however I pleased."
"It's alright now. Once we join the Grasslanders, we'll offer a portion of these silver taels to them. Then we'll buy an official position and return to Shengtian!"
"..."
Several days later, a heavy snowfall began, signaling the arrival of winter.
The Marauders' advance finally reached Shengtian, but they were met with an empty city—the Imperial Capital, completely undefended.
In the winter of the twelfth year of the Taiwen era, the Marauders entered the pass. Tuwa Ha'er effortlessly seized the Maple Country's Imperial Capital, Shengtian!
The Maple Country's Royal Family and court, along with the entire nation, fled south, relocating the capital to Jiangzhou.
In early spring of the following year, the Grasslanders formally established their own kingdom, naming it Great Wu!
The founding era was designated Taiyuan.
In the first year of Taiyuan, the various Grassland tribes completely conquered several provinces of the former Maple Country, leaving the land in ruins.
Large-scale migrations from the Bandong Grasslands began, with the Grasslanders bringing their elderly, weak, women, and children to repopulate the conquered provinces.
Meanwhile, Gao Yudong, the Grand Councilor who had embezzled tens of thousands of silver taels, was appointed to a minor official position in the Wu Dynasty.
When this news reached the Southern Maple court, they were enraged, grinding their teeth in fury and wishing they could tear Gao Yudong limb from limb.
In the first year of Taiyuan, Tuwa Ha'er, who styled himself the Sage Ruler, issued two decrees.
The first ordered the capture and execution of all Martial Artists across the land, along with the search for any remaining Divine Weapons and Magical weapons hidden within the Jianghu.
The second decree offered a substantial reward to any blacksmith in the world capable of forging Divine Weapons.
The first decree immediately sparked resistance from Martial Artists everywhere.
